The text came from a friend that the Spirit had led her to share something with me which she'd read by Oswald Chambers.  It's my favorite revelation so far in 2019 and worth repeating.

"The greatest word of Jesus to His disciples is abandon. It means to be completely abandoned to the Spirit's guidance, with no thought to where He's leading or how to get there."

Well, that makes no sense to the way we live life does it, but oh how I want to live that way!!
Here's more.

"Jesus summed up commonsense carefulness in the life of the disciples as UNBELIEF.  If we have received the Spirit of God, He will squeeze right thru our lives, as if to ask 'Now where do I come into this relationship, vacation you have planned, or these new books you want to read?'"

Well, that was a show stopper. I'd just picked up three random books at the library and mailed a silly book called The Wonkey Donkey to our Minnesota grandchildren in hopes of bringing some laughter into their lives while their mom was in the hospital.
Chambers continues
"He (God) always presses the point until we learn to make Him our first consideration...do not worry about your life. Don't take the pressure of your provision upon yourself."

Say what?  Are you kidding me?

"It is not only wrong to worry, it is unbelief. Worry means we do not believe God can look after the practical details that worry us.  Have you ever noticed what Jesus said would choke the Word?...Is it the devil?  No!-'the cares of this world.' (Mt 13:22)  It is always our little worries.  We say, 'I will not trust what I cannot see.'-and that is when unbelief begins. The only cure for unbelief is obedience to the Spirit."

"..do not worry about your life, what you will eat or what you will drink; nor about your body, what  you will put on it."  Matthew 6:25
